How we handle customs clearance

Your goods always arrive already officially cleared. For private orders and small shipments — simplified (cargo) clearance: it’s already included in the delivery price, with minimal paperwork on your side. For business — full official clearance with a declaration, VAT and certification. We tailor the scheme to your task.

Simplified (cargo)

For individuals and small shipments
  • Consolidated cargo, charged by weight / volume
  • Simplified customs clearance included in the price
  • Goods arrive already officially cleared
  • Minimal paperwork from the client
  • Short timelines and a low per-kg rate

Full official clearance

Documents and VAT — for business
  • Customs declaration for the shipment
  • Contract, invoices, certificates, VAT
  • Official documents for the goods and costs
  • Certification and labeling to market requirements
  • Input VAT recovery for companies on the general tax regime

What to choose: An order for yourself or a small batch — go simplified (cargo); purchasing through a company, VAT, tenders, retail, or a marketplace requiring full documentation — go full official clearance.

Full official clearance is available for all delivery destinations; it is not included in the shipping rate — standard clearance rates are calculated separately.

What formal delivery includes

  • Contract holder — us, or your own foreign-trade contract under currency control
  • Customs declaration: DT (EAEU) / GTD (Uzbekistan) in your legal entity’s name
  • VAT paid and recoverable (for VAT payers on the general tax regime)
  • EAC / Asl Belgisi (UZ) certification, declarations of conformity
  • Closing documents: contract, invoice, DT/GTD, tax invoice / UPD
  • Meets marketplace requirements (Wildberries, Ozon, Kaspi)

Three models of formal import

We pick one of three schemes to fit your task and how involved you want to be in foreign-trade operations. Which models are available for your country — check with your manager.

Direct import from the factory

You are the importer under a contract with the exporting factory. Import VAT at the border, recoverable on the general tax regime. The most transparent and least expensive scheme — it requires a factory with an export license and currency control (Federal Law 173-FZ in Russia).

Through a trading house

A Chinese trading house consolidates suppliers that have no export license. You are still the importer, the VAT mechanics are the same, plus the intermediary’s commission. Convenient when you have several suppliers.

Full-service

We import in our own legal entity’s name and hand the goods over to you inside the country with 20% VAT on the invoice (recoverable on the general tax regime). Zero foreign-trade burden on your side — the most expensive but the simplest scheme.

Document package by client type

Individual (cargo)

Product link/description, country, contact. Nothing else needed — simplified customs clearance is included in the delivery price.

Sole trader

Sole-trader registration extract, tax ID, contract, invoice and packing list from the supplier, bank-transfer details. For marketplaces — labeling codes.

Company with VAT

Statutory documents, foreign-trade contract under currency control, DT/GTD, EAC certificates, tax invoice/UPD for VAT recovery.

Full official clearance costs more than simplified — but not as much as it seems

At face value, full official clearance comes out about 30–50% more expensive than simplified (cargo) per kilogram — due to duty, VAT and certification. But for a company on the general tax regime, input VAT is recoverable, so the real difference after recovery usually narrows to around 10–20%.

In return you get live marketplace listings (with no risk of being blocked for missing import documents), closing documents, the ability to take part in tenders and to work formally.
